The United States Phenolic Resin for Refractories Market size was valued at USD 2.5 Billion in 2022 and is projected to reach USD 4.1 Billion by 2030, growing at a CAGR of 6.5% from 2024 to 2030.
The United States phenolic resin for refractories market is a crucial segment of the industrial materials sector, driven by its importance in producing heat-resistant products. Phenolic resins are widely used in refractory applications due to their high thermal stability and mechanical strength. As industries like steel, cement, and glass continue to grow, the demand for high-performance refractory materials also increases. These resins contribute to the durability and resistance of refractories to harsh temperatures and chemical environments. The U.S. phenolic resin for refractories market is characterized by regional variations in demand, driven by industrial concentration in different areas. The largest demand is observed in regions with a high concentration of manufacturing industries, such as the Midwest and the South. These areas host numerous steel, cement, and glass manufacturers, all of which require high-quality refractories for production. The West Coast and Northeast regions also show significant growth due to technological advancements and industrial diversification. Key states like Ohio, Pennsylvania, and Texas are major hubs for refractory consumption, while states with a focus on infrastructure development and energy efficiency are seeing increasing demand for phenolic resins.
